Captain Bryan Smither
Captain Bryan's story is a tale woven with the threads of nature, and it all began in the vibrant landscapes of South Africa. Born and raised surrounded by the beauty of the wild, Bryan's life has been a dance with the elements. If he's not riding the waves in the ocean, you can bet he's sailing on them. And on those rare occasions when he's not in close proximity to the ocean, he's probably daydreaming about it.
Coming from a family deeply rooted in adventurous, ocean-centric pursuits, it was almost destiny for Bryan to find his calling in sailing. But here's the kicker – Captain Bryan is not your average seafarer. Sure, he's a charter captain, but that's just the tip of the iceberg.
This man wears many hats, or should I say, life jackets? He's a dive instructor, a surf instructor/guide, a marathon canoeist, a yoga instructor, a wellness expert, a masseuse, a free diver, and to top it off, a keen fisherman who's cast his line in some of the world's most remote archipelagos.
Bryan's yachting journey has taken him through the waves of South Africa and the Caribbean, and for the past nine months, he's been navigating the waters around the US Virgin Islands and the British Virgin Islands with lucky guests on board Walk'n on Sunshine.
Get ready for a journey where Captain Bryan brings his love for nature, adventure, and a touch of wellness to the high seas. On Walk'n on Sunshine, every wave tells a story, and Bryan is here to make sure it's an unforgettable one for all aboard. 🌊⛵☀️
Chef Nicole
Meet Chef Nicole Alton, your positive nomad hailing from the Rocky Mountains of Canada. Born with a wanderlust spirit, Nicole has been lucky enough to explore the world since she was a little girl. Her heart beats for experiencing new cultures, discovering beautiful places, and wandering wherever the wind takes her.
But there's more to Nicole than just her love for travel. Nestled alongside her passion for the ocean is a genuine love for people. With a solid 12 years in the hospitality industry, she's donned many hats, always aiming to craft beautiful experiences for guests. And when it comes to being the chef on your catamaran, Nicole takes it up a notch – she's not just your chef; she's your friend and go-to gal for anything that can elevate your experience on this beautiful adventure.
Picture this: Nicole has whipped up culinary wonders around the Exuma islands in the Bahamas, sailed across the vast Atlantic Ocean, and now, it's time for her to sprinkle her magic in the US Virgin Islands and the British Virgin Islands alongside Captain Jayjay and their fantastic guests!
Get ready for a culinary journey that's not just about the food but about the warmth and joy Nicole brings to the table. With Chef Nicole on board, your adventure is about to get a whole lot more delicious and unforgettable! 🌮🍹🌴
